Articles & guides

Long-form writing on expected goals, shot quality, and the models behind the xG numbers you see on broadcasts. All articles are free and written to be understandable whether you are brand new to football analytics or comfortable reading an academic paper.

  • What is expected goals (xG)? A complete beginner’s guide

    ~12 minute read · Updated April 2026

    The origin of xG, how it’s calculated, what a “good” xG looks like, common misconceptions, and how to read an xG shot map. If you are starting from zero, start here.

  • How xG models differ, and why their numbers rarely match

    ~10 minute read · Updated April 2026

    A side-by-side tour of the academic xG models used in this calculator: Rathke’s zone model, the Kos Angle, Anzer & Bauer’s positional model, CNN pixel-based xG, and more. Find out why the same shot gets a different xG from each one.

  • xG glossary: every football analytics term explained

    ~10 minute read · Updated April 2026

    xA, xT, PSxG, SHAP, ROC-AUC, Kos Angle, shot maps — plain-English definitions of the terms you’ll see in analytics articles, Twitter/X threads and broadcasts.